Reliability matters a lot in our case because we send business-critical notifications. Missed notifications can mean missed deadlines and unhappy customers. With our old system we had to build our own retry logic and it was never as robust as it needed to be. There were always edge cases we had not accounted for.
SuprSend handles retries automatically. If a provider fails to deliver, it retries based on configurable rules. If the primary provider is down entirely it falls back to the secondary one. We have seen this work in practice a few times and it has been seamless.
The uptime has been consistent and we have not experienced any downtime on the SuprSend side. The notification logs give us proof of delivery which is important for our compliance requirements. When a customer asks whether they were notified we can show the exact delivery trail.
We also use the webhook integration to push all notification events to our monitoring system. If something unusual happens, like a sudden spike in failures, we catch it through our own alerting.
